Furthermore, the physical demographics of the Uzbekistan population present a highly diverse spectrum of skin phenotypes. The population ranges from Eastern European complexions (Fitzpatrick Skin Type II) to deep Central Asian and Middle Eastern pigmentations (Fitzpatrick Skin Types III, IV, and V). Standard single-wavelength laser systems often fall short of delivering safety and efficacy simultaneously across this spectrum. This creates a strong clinical mandate for multi-wavelength platforms (755nm + 808nm + 940nm + 1064nm) capable of targeting hair follicles at multiple depths without causing thermal injury to the surrounding melanin-rich epidermis.

Global Industrial Status & Technology Trends in Laser Epilation

The global diode laser market has transitioned from basic photo-thermolysis tools to highly complex, intelligent workstations integrated with cloud computing, artificial intelligence (AI), and advanced thermal management systems. Across North America, Europe, and Asia-Pacific, clinical clinics are standardizing high-power platforms that run at energy levels exceeding 2000W to 4000W. Higher power allows for shorter pulse widths (sub-10ms), which is crucial for achieving selective photothermolysis of thin and light hairs without exposing the dermis to excessive thermal load.

Four-Wavelength Synergy

Simultaneous emission of 755nm, 808nm, 940nm, and 1064nm targets deep hair bulbs, vascular feeders, and superficial hair structures in one pass.

AI Skin Diagnostics

Smart optical sensors embedded within the handpiece analyze epidermal melanin content in real-time, auto-adjusting safe fluence parameters.

B2B IoT Connectivity

Cloud database integration enables clinic managers to remotely monitor flash usage, analyze shot efficiency, and run preventive hardware diagnostics.

The latest industrial standards also mandate the transition from standard macro-channel cooling stacks to micro-channel cooling (MCC) or gold-tin bonding technologies. These mechanical innovations protect the semiconductor bars from hot spots and rapid aging, ensuring the machine maintains a life span of up to 50 million to 100 million shots. Localized Application Scenarios in Uzbekistan

Operating professional medical-aesthetic lasers in Central Asia requires an understanding of localized challenges: environmental temperatures, stable electricity grids, and demographic skin-type variations. Sourcing platforms without considering these parameters can result in frequent machine failures and reduced treatment safety.

1. Active Cooling for Hot Arid Climates

During summer, temperatures in regions like Tashkent, Bukhara, and Khiva can rise above 40°C. Standard beauty lasers equipped only with passive cooling systems can quickly overheat, forcing the software to pause treatments to protect the diode bars. V-Cest Beauty’s systems feature Thermoelectric Cooling (TEC) and active chiller modules, allowing clinics to operate continuously for up to 15 hours, even in hot ambient temperatures.

2. Voltage Stabilization for Regional Power Grids

Fluctuations in electricity grids outside major cities can damage sensitive micro-electronics. Our systems are built with wide-voltage input stabilizers and emergency breaker systems, protecting key parts like capacitor banks and central processors from power surges.

3. Multi-Wavelength Delivery for Complex Skin Types

The diverse demographics of the region mean a single clinic might treat fair skin (Fitzpatrick Type II) and deeply tanned skin (Fitzpatrick Type V) in the same afternoon. Our multi-wavelength handpieces blend:

  • 755nm Alexandrite: Targets shallow melanin for thin, light hair.
  • 808nm Classic Diode: Deep penetration for thick, coarse hair.
  • 940nm Wavelength: Coagulates micro-vessels feeding the hair bulb.
  • 1064nm Nd:YAG: Safe for darker skin types, bypassing epidermal melanin to avoid surface burns.

B2B Sourcing Strategy & Import Logistics for Uzbekistan

Sourcing medical lasers involves navigating global shipping routes and local customs clearance. When importing high-power aesthetic equipment (categorized under HS Code: 9018909000 or similar medical classifications) into Uzbekistan, B2B buyers must coordinate documentation and transit logistics carefully to prevent delays at customs.

Logistical Channels: China to Uzbekistan

As Central Asia is landlocked, shipping routes must utilize land or air transport:

  • Air Freight (Fast Track): Direct routes from Beijing (PEK) or Guangzhou (CAN) to Tashkent Yuzhny International Airport (TAS). This is the preferred method for high-value aesthetic lasers, reducing transit time to 3–5 business days and minimizing physical vibrations during transport.
  • Rail & Road Freight (Economic Route): Rail lines from Chongqing or Xi'an transit through Urumqi and Alashankou/Khorgos, crossing Kazakhstan to reach Tashkent. Road transport by heavy freight trucks via Khorgos offers a balance between cost and delivery speed, typically taking 12–18 days.

Compliance and Documentation

Importers in Uzbekistan must present standard customs documentation, including a Commercial Invoice, Packing List, Certificate of Origin (to verify manufacturing sourcing), and compliance certificates. Having CE, ISO 13485, or CE-MDR documentation simplifies the registration and licensing process with local health authorities. 1. What is the advantage of 4-wavelength technology (755/808/940/1064nm) for the Uzbek market?
The population of Uzbekistan features a diverse mix of skin types, from fair (Fitzpatrick Type II) to olive and dark brown (Types III-V). Single-wavelength systems (like 808nm only) are less versatile. A 4-wavelength system delivers different wavelengths simultaneously: 755nm for light, fine hair; 808nm for classic hair types; 940nm to target micro-vessels feeding the hair follicle; and 1064nm to safely bypass epidermal melanin in darker skin, reducing the risk of burns.
